Applications
Purification of human or animal viral RNA and DNA from serum, plasma, swab, and tissue homogenates
Features
Convenient and highly efficient sample lysis by liquid Proteinase K
Reliable virus detection from fresh or frozen serum / plasma treated with EDTA / citrate
Highest sensitivity for DNA and RNA viruses e.g., Blue Tongue Virus and Cytomegalovirus
Specifications
Technology: Silica membrane technology
Fragment size: 100 bp–approx. 50 kbp
NucleoSpin® 8 Virus
Processing: Manual or automated
Sample material: Biological fluids (< 150 μL)
Typical recovery: > 90 %
Elution volume: 70–100 μL
Binding capacity: 40 μg
Processing time: 60 min/48 preps
NucleoSpin® 96 Virus
Processing: Manual or automated
Sample material: Cell-free biological fluids (< 150 μL)
Typical recovery: > 90 %
Elution volume: 70–100 μL
Binding capacity: 40 μg
Processing time: 60 min/96 preps
Proportional detectability of viral DNA/RNA even at low titers
Nucleic acids were extracted from dilution series of DNA (blue) and RNA (orange) viruses and quantified by qPCR. Both viral DNA and viral RNA were detected with high sensitivity (down to 100 viral particles/µL for DNA; down to 800 viral particles/µL for viral RNA).
